① 有哪些比較好用的低代碼開發平台
「低代碼」是 Forrester Research 於 2014 年提出的概念,指一種主要應用於企業信息化領域的快速開發技術。藉助低代碼,開發者無需編碼即可生成企業應用的常見功能,少量編碼能開發出更多擴展功能。憑借著更低技術門檻、更高開發效率等優勢,低代碼開發技術備受行業和投資界的追捧。
中國軟體行業協會、中國軟體網聯合全球領先的開發工具廠商葡萄城發布了《2020 中國低代碼開發平台十大發展趨勢》,對低代碼開發平台的發展表示樂觀。報告中認為,企業用戶對低代碼開發的需求不斷增長,大型企業用戶應用低代碼開發平台的成功案例日益增多隨著低代碼應用場景不斷拓寬,2020 年會有更多企業或企業信息化服務提供商將採用技術門檻更低、開發效率更高的低代碼開發平台,為自己量身定做企業核心系統以滿足個性化的企業管理需求。
本文將帶您回顧低代碼開發領域國內外的主流玩家,希望能對您的技術選型起到幫助作用。根據低代碼廠商的關注點和盈利模式,筆者將低代碼產品分為六大類。
原生低代碼廠商
這部分是指專門為低代碼行業而生的廠商,這部分廠商雖然創立時間不長,但憑借著融資能力,正在快速發展。這一類別中,投資方性質和關注點的差異會很大程度上影響到產品的發展方向,如國外的OutSystems投資方為KKR(大型私募),更關注成本和現金流,所以產品發展上更突出產品力,推廣也是以大型、超大型企業集團為主;而國內的氚雲主要投資方是阿里系(互聯網基金),更關注流量和市佔率,所以產品發展上傾向於在降低門檻、與釘釘等流量平台整合,走的是互聯網的路線。
開發工具廠商
這部分是指以前專門做軟體開發工具的廠商,整合自身的開發工具資源後推出了低代碼產品。這部分廠商的產品技術能力很強,編程擴展性、可維護性等方面的競爭力也有保障。考慮到開發工具市場的頭部效應較明顯,推出低代碼產品的開發工具廠商並不多,但是都是有幾十年歷史的老廠。典型產品有Progress(代表產品有Telerik、KendoUI)的Kinvey和GrapeCity(代表產品有Spread、ActiveReport)的活字格。產品發展方向上以產品力提升、應用場景擴展為主,在技術門檻和擴展性中間會更傾向於後者。所以,用戶主要集中在初創型軟體開發團隊、做定製化交付的行業軟體代理商、系統集成商和中大企業IT中心,而不是一線業務人員。運營模式為傳統的toB,給企業客戶更多信心,而不是爭取更多普通用戶使用。
雲平台廠商
做雲平台的廠商,希望藉助低代碼吸引更多用戶購買其雲服務。低代碼在產品線中並不在核心位置上,大多專注於解決「有沒有」的問題。代表性產品有Microsoft的PowerApps和阿里雲的宜搭。依託於雲平台廠商的研發能力,這些產品的易用性有較強的競爭力。考慮到其定位於「引流」,發展方向上以深度整合自家雲資源,降低門檻為主,互聯網路線是這些廠商的共同選擇,當然如果您希望使用這些產品與來自第三方廠商的企業系統進行集成,可能會遭遇不容忽視的挑戰和風險。
行業軟體廠商
行業軟體廠商,希望利用低代碼技術降低實施、特別是實施中客戶化開發環節的工作量,提升行業軟體自身的競爭力。典型產品有Salesforce的Customer 360(原Lightning)和用友的iUAP。這些產品嚴格意義上屬於行業軟體的一個模塊,與主幹產品同步,通常不會單獨銷售和運營。這就意味著,您只能使用這些低代碼開發平台為其主幹產品做客戶化開發,開發出來的系統通常無法獨立部署和運行,也不具備遷移的可能性。
BPM廠商
專注於流程和表單的BPM廠商在自身軟體的基礎上增加可視化設計器,進一步降低使用門檻後,就實現了向低代碼的轉型。典型代表有國外的K2和國內的炎黃盈動AWS PaaS。這部分產品的核心優勢是強大的工作流引擎,目前主要的發展方向集中於提升頁面定製程度。但是,這種基於表單而不是數據模型的架構,更像是「零代碼」,在應對復雜應用場景時會遇到諸多障礙,這也是限制這類廠商發展的主要原因。
數據處理軟體廠商
與BPM廠商類似,數據處理軟體本身可以歸入零代碼,廠商為產品追加編程介面、增強界面控制能力後即轉型為低代碼。這類軟體在國內比較多,如魔方網表、雲表等。從目前的情況看,這些產品的架構設計依然傾向於數據處理而不是開發工具,在白標、頁面定製、移動端支持、系統集成等領域通常存在較大差距,更適合在企業內部使用,解決信息化的「有無問題」。如果您是相對獨立運營的IT部門或者第三方軟體服務提供商,這類產品的可交付性是必須要考慮的問題。
被網友戲稱為「夢幻開局」的2020年,對於絕大多數企業而言,註定是一個充滿挑戰的年份。如果您正在為企業信息化尋找一個更具創造性的方案,以達到降低開發成本、加快交付周期的目的,請千萬不要忽略了低代碼技術。如果您不知道如何下手評估這六類廠商產品,作為軟體行業的老兵,筆者的建議如下:
如果您是企業內部使用,應用場景較簡單,建議從「雲平台廠商」著手。更低的技術門檻和更低的啟動成本會讓您的應用快速落地;如果您是系統集成商,或者應用場景較復雜(不限於當前階段的需求,而是可預期的未來您希望開發的全部功能),筆者更推薦來自「開發工具廠商」的產品,更強大擴展能力可以保障開發工具不會成為您項目交付的技術瓶頸。
工欲善其事必先利其器,最後,筆者祝大家都能找到適合自己的開發工具,在這個特殊的一年中,為軟體開發和企業信息化工作提速!
轉載自簡書:低代碼觀察員
② 現在低代碼平台很火啊,想來湊湊熱鬧,觀察一下局勢;主流的開發平台有哪些
您好,對於這個問題,我很願意分享一下我的經歷。
因為工作原因我接觸過不少的低代碼開發平台,在市場上口碑較好的有:簡道雲、氚雲、百數等。
宜搭是阿里的新兒子,論成熟度沒有其他產品那麼高。因此這裡面比較成熟的產品是簡道雲與百數,簡道雲作為帆軟的旗下品牌,報表數據方面簡直就是王者,占據了不錯的優勢。
百數側重於對二次開發的探索,據了解他們有著一套完整的二次開發體系,不僅支持用Python腳本語言進行開發,還支持用功能模塊進行下載安裝來支持功能擴展。最新出來的數據助手在數據管理方面用起來也蠻方便的,對於企業而言也解決了不少麻煩。
以上就是我的分享,蘿卜白菜各有所愛,大家根據自己的需求選擇就行了。
③ 現在好用的無代碼零代碼開發平台有哪些,求推薦
想要一款好用的無代碼零代碼開發平台?
百數低代碼開發平台了解一下
這款低代碼開發平台是由長沙異次元網路科技有限公司歷經8年研發,別看是低代碼開發平台,實際上擁有無代碼或者零代碼開發平台的所有功能。
零代碼開發平台的優勢其實搭建簡單方便,操作小白也能上手。
但是百數低代碼開發的操作方式也是通過托拉拽進行配置,與無代碼的搭建方法其實是一樣的。
除此之外,還支持後端Python腳本語言進行開發,這一點對於企業的開發人員就非常方便。一旦企業發展越來越好,對系統的需求要提高時,就可以讓稍微懂Python的人直接進行擴展,並不需要重新去定製與依賴專業的開發人員才能進行,簡單高效。
不僅如此,還提供web API介面,支持企業對接其他系統數據以及相關資料,便於企業數據共享與資源共享,提高了效率的同時還節省了成本。(PS:很多零代碼開發平台如果需要對接第三方系統,則需要花大價錢去購買相應的介面才行)
總而言之,低代碼開發平台從綜合的角度來說更適合於企業發展,感興趣的朋友不妨來試一試啊!
謝謝
④ 請問低代碼市場發展如何
隨著中國發展的進一步的擴大和深入,帶來了國民經濟飛速發展,當前中國企業正面臨著前所未有的機遇和挑戰,競爭日趨激烈,新的業務和交易渠道不斷涌現,企業需要不斷快速交付和適應性調整。在這樣一個不斷創新、迅速發展變化的環境中,大量客戶本身的業務模式、市場定位都在不斷的演化過程中,相應的IT 應用也需要隨之改變以適應新業務的需要。IT如何適應業務調整和變化的問題,使得信息技術部門承擔著巨大的壓力,在整個企業級IT 信息系統的規劃和建設中面臨著一系列艱苦的挑戰:IT如何快速實現業務需求?IT如何靈活應付業務變化?IT如何管控和治理應用系統提升業務績效?IT 服務於業務,為了提升IT 與業務一致性的能力,我們先分析一下我們是如何做業務的。為了增強IT 與業務一致性的能力,我們必須改變過去以系統為中心的建設方式,按照做業務的方式去做IT,把活動和流程從系統中解放出來,也即以活動(又稱為服務,Service)、過程(又稱為流程,Process)為核心。基於服務,快速實現業務需求。服務成為實現業務需求的基本單位。服務可以新建,也可以既有封裝,或者通過服務組裝和流程編排的方式實現。服務的整合、復用和積累,加速了實現業務需求的過程。基於服務,靈活應對業務變化。服務之間能夠快速進行集成,從而構成新的業務流程,當業務過程變化的時候,可以通過對服務的重新編排快速的響應。業務流程不再是僵化的,不再需要花費巨大的改造成本。基於服務,持續管控和治理應用系統提升業務績效。IT 的服務、流程直接反映了業務經營的狀況,服務、流程的管理和監控,為業務績效的改進提供了巨大的可能性,它可以告訴我們在流程的那些地方存在改進的空間,並為改進業務績效提供直接的信息支持。基於java語言進行開發,採用SOA 技術架構,進行服務化的分割包裝,通過ESB 注冊管理起來,ESB 主要完成消息轉換、路由等通信機制,較後通過BPM 進行流程編排,從而把一些服務組裝成一個新的業務。在業務需求變化的時候,只要通過上層的業務流程的調整,即可快速實現對新業務需求的支持。 SOA技術架構,是一種業務驅動的IT 體系架構方式,支持對業務的整合,使其成為一種相互聯系、可重用的業務任務或服務。其核心就是把企業組織的業務流程功能模塊劃分為服務,並對外提供標準的介面,基於這些服務,組織內部的不同業務部門或是不同組織可以快速組合所需的業務流程。 FASNET平台業務應用系統開發採用的是業務驅動的開發(Business-driven development , BDD)模式,它是一種由業務需求驅動的端到端軟體開發方法。BDD 支持快速開發和部署能以較少的成本滿足業務需求的靈活解決方案。它是一種用於實現 SOA 的機制。業務驅動的開發是用於開發 SOA 解決方案的基於角色的開發流程。它收集業務分析人員梳理的業務流程和確定的需求,所得到的流程模型和業務構件可以隨後用於下游 IT 開發和實現,供架構師用於進行系統設計、供開發人員用於進行開發、供集成開發人員進行流程編排和部署以及質保工程師用於進行測試。 FASNET平台業務應用產品開發時序。想了解更多相關信息,可以咨詢SDP軟體開發平台!